I there a way to squelch individuals on Channel 200, or to squelch the entire channel?

Yes. Easy. Go to the comms box into which '200' is entered and then enter a different number and press return. You can surpress other channels and individuals with:-

.squelch 1    .unsquelch 1

I think there's an  .unsquelch all command but I can't remember it now.

Or you can right click the tabs and choose edit settings and tick and untick what you like. You can even create new tabs depending on mood and activity. I have one names 'Peace'  :rofl

the .squelch <name> command mutes a person on all channels. Another option is to opt out the entire channel from the view. When you move your cursor to the upper frame of the text buffer, you'll see tabs and right clicking on the bar gives you options to choose from.

You can also find the intended player you want to squelch in the roster.  Left click to highlight player, then right click to choose your options for dealing with the chosen player.
